Common Dogwood (Cornus sanguinea) is a hardy, deciduous native shrub prized for its vivid red stems, striking through the winter months. Creamy white flowers cluster in early summer, followed by small black berries in autumn that feed birds, though they are not edible for humans. This adaptable red dogwood shrub tolerates a wide range of soils, including clay and sandy ground, and grows in full sun to partial shade, reaching 1.5 to 3 metres. Popular for hedging and woodland gardens, Common Dogwood also supports pollinators and shelters wildlife.

Its intense red stems stand out beautifully against evergreen planting, especially in winter, making Common Dogwood one of the most striking native shrubs for year round garden interest.

Tolerant of wet soils and well suited to erosion control, Common Dogwood is a versatile choice among UK shrubs for borders, hedging and challenging planting sites.
